Breaking the Stigma: How Hearing Aids Improve Lives
For many people, hearing loss is an invisible challenge, one that’s usually met with misunderstanding or even stigma. While advances in medical technology have given rise to units like hearing aids, there stays a pervasive perception that wearing them is a sign of weakness or a step toward aging. Nonetheless, hearing aids have come a long way, not only in terms of their dimension and functionality but in their ability to significantly improve the quality of life for many who use them. The stigma surrounding hearing aids is slowly however steadily being broken down, and understanding their prodiscovered impact can assist shift perceptions and open the door for more folks to seek help once they need it.
Understanding Hearing Aids
At their core, hearing aids are devices designed to amplify sound for individuals who experience hearing loss. Whether or not it's attributable to age, injury, or medical conditions, hearing loss can occur in varied forms. Modern hearing aids are incredibly sophisticated, capable of adjusting sound levels and filtering out background noise, making conversations and interactions clearer and more natural. These devices are designed to restore a way of auditory clarity, permitting customers to have interaction in conversations, enjoy music, and participate in social settings without the fixed challenge of straining to hear.
Gone are the times when hearing aids have been bulky, clunky devices worn with a sense of reluctance. Today’s models are small, discreet, and packed with advanced options like Bluetooth connectivity, rechargeable batteries, and even smartphone integration, allowing customers to control settings via apps. The improvements in both aesthetics and technology have made hearing aids more accessible and more appealing to a wider audience.
The Impact on Emotional Well-being
Hearing loss isn’t just a physical challenge; it has a profound emotional and psychological impact. Individuals with untreated hearing loss often face isolation and frustration as a consequence of problem understanding speech and engaging in social interactions. This can lead to emotions of loneliness, depression, and nervousness, additional exacerbating the problem. For many, the concern of stigma related with hearing aids prevents them from seeking help, permitting these negative emotional effects to persist.
However, hearing aids have the ability to reverse this cycle. By improving one’s ability to listen to and communicate, hearing aids reduce the sense of isolation, enabling users to participate more absolutely in social interactions. The positive emotional benefits are sometimes quick: customers report feeling more assured, less anxious, and more linked to these around them. In truth, research have shown that individuals who use hearing aids are more likely to expertise improvements in mental health, with lower levels of depression and better overall quality of life.
Enhancing Cognitive Perform
The benefits of hearing aids extend beyond emotional well-being. Untreated hearing loss is linked to cognitive decline, because the brain is forced to work harder to process sounds and speech, which can lead to memory issues and reduced cognitive perform over time. Wearing hearing aids helps reduce this cognitive load, allowing the brain to process sounds more effectively. This can have a significant impact on general cognitive health, particularly for older adults.
Current research suggests that individuals with hearing loss who wear hearing aids are less likely to experience cognitive decline and dementia compared to those who do not. By restoring auditory enter to the brain, hearing aids help protect cognitive function and assist brain health, making them a crucial tool for sustaining mental acuity as we age.
Social and Professional Benefits
Some of the discoverable benefits of hearing aids is the improvement they bring to social and professional interactions. Within the workplace, hearing loss can create communication limitations, leading to misunderstandings, missed opportunities, and a lack of confidence in participating in meetings or discussions. By wearing hearing aids, individuals can regain their ability to hear clearly, boosting their professional performance and enhancing their relationships with colleagues.
Socially, hearing aids facilitate better interactions with friends, family, and beloved ones. Whether it’s participating in group conversations, watching television, or simply enjoying a meal out at a restaurant, hearing aids make these everyday moments more accessible and enjoyable. This, in turn, helps to combat the isolation often associated with hearing loss.
Overcoming the Stigma
Despite the many benefits, there remains a stigma attached to wearing hearing aids. This stigma is often rooted in outdated perceptions of hearing loss as a sign of aging or frailty. Nonetheless, as technology continues to improve, the narrative surrounding hearing aids is beginning to change. Hearing aids are not any longer considered as an emblem of aging however reasonably as a tool for enhancing life and maintaining independence.
Breaking this stigma requires education, understanding, and the willingness to embrace technology as a tool for empowerment. As more folks share their tales of how hearing aids have improved their lives, others are inspired to take the step toward seeking help. The benefits of hearing aids far outweigh any perceived social drawbacks, and it’s crucial to challenge the notion that wearing them is something to be ashamed of.
Conclusion
Hearing aids are life-altering units that go beyond improving hearing; they enhance emotional well-being, help cognitive perform, and enable better social and professional interactment. By breaking the stigma surrounding hearing aids and embracing them as a tool for empowerment, individuals with hearing loss can lead fuller, more linked lives. As technology continues to evolve, so too will the opportunities for people to beat the challenges of hearing loss and break free from the barriers that after held them back.
